Forecast: Fresh Undulate Ray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ption in the UK

In 2024, the forecasted value for fresh undulate ray production in the UK is 1.04 thousand euros per metric ton. This marks a decline from 2023's actual figure. The year-on-year data from 2025 to 2028 projects continuous decreases: a 11.5% drop in 2025, a 12.4% dip in 2026, a 13.8% decrease in 2027, and a 15.7% fall in 2028.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) over this period is negative.
